Overview
Mastercard is looking for a Principal Information Security Consultant based in London, Dunstable, or Harrogate. This senior role sits within Vocalink and provides strategic security leadership across critical products and enterprise platforms. As a Principal Security Consultant, you will act as a trusted advisor and senior technical delegate to the Director of Information Security Consultancy - providing expert guidance, shaping strategy, and representing the Consultancy function in cross-organisation forums. You will operate with high autonomy, influencing complex decisions and raising the maturity and consistency of security engineering practices across Mastercard.
Responsibilities• Lead high-impact security consultancy engagements across the enterprise.• Shape and mature the Security Consultancy function.• Act as a senior delegate for the Director of Information Security Engineering.• Provide authoritative guidance to engineering, product, and architecture teams.• Lead assurance for high-risk or complex systems.• Develop, refine, and promote security standards and frameworks.• Mentor Lead-level consultants.• Provide strategic direction on complex technical domains such as cryptography, IAM, network, data and application security
All About You• Strong security mindset and deep knowledge of best practices and threats.• Broad and mature experience across software, architecture, network, cloud, and assurance.• Ability to negotiate with senior stakeholders.• Strong interpersonal and relationship-building skills.• Authority in complex technical decision-making.• Confidence in providing technical guidance on complex decisions (cryptography, network design, application security, data protection, IAM, etc.)
• Experience producing high-quality documentation and threat models.• Familiarity with ISO 27001, NIST SP 800-53, PCI DSS, etc.• Self-starter comfortable with ambiguity.• Experience with third-party assurance and vendor interaction.• Proactive approach to enhancing the maturity of the security organisation
Desirable Experience• Security certifications (CISSP, CISM, CSSLP, CISA).• Threat modelling and risk assessment expertise.• Knowledge of PAM, Secrets Management, PKI, Cryptography, Security Logging.• Experience with JIRA/Confluence.

What you need to know about the London Tech Scene
London isn't just a hub for established businesses; it's also a nursery for innovation. Boasting one of the most recognized fintech ecosystems in Europe, attracting billions in investments each year, London's success has made it a go-to destination for startups looking to make their mark. Top U.K. companies like Hoptin, Moneybox and Marshmallow have already made the city their base — yet fintech is just the beginning. From healthtech to renewable energy to cybersecurity and beyond, the city's startups are breaking new ground across a range of industries.
